| Joe's Diner | Lee, MA | |
|
Very small but comfortable restaraunt. Was the inspiration
for Norman Rockwell's "Runaway" painting. Joe is the cook in
the painting, and comes out of the kitchen often to greet customers.
Very warm atmosphere. Open from very early to very late, ...
